The Governor of Rivers State, Nyesom Wike, has warned President Muhammadu Buhari to deal with the demands of Nigerians, or he’ll put the country “on fire”.
Wike’s remark comes two days after the federal government met with leaders within the South-South region.
On the meeting, the South-South leaders demanded the restructuring of Nigeria, in line with the principle of true federalism.

Wike, talking on Channels Television’s Sunrise Daily on Thursday, stated: “We should perceive on this nation that political management may be very key.
“Having the political will to implement what the folks need may be very critical.
“I don’t need to speak in regards to the concern of distrust or no belief in government. People have raised such points, that they don’t assume that something will come out of all this dialogue. I don’t agree with that. I consider that if the president doesn’t do, given the alternatives he has now, then, he will likely be placing Nigeria on fire.”
